The most recent mileage data for the Volvo XC90 (2014-19) indicates that the majority of vehicles have relatively low to moderate mileage. About 15.9% of these vehicles record mileage of 0 to 10,000 miles, and a further 14.6% have between 20,000 to 30,000 miles, suggesting many vehicles are relatively new or lightly driven. The largest segment, comprising 18.3%, has mileage between 30,000 and 40,000 miles. Higher mileage vehicles, such as those over 100,000 miles, make up a smaller proportion, with just 2.4% between 110,000 and 120,000 miles and only 1.2% exceeding 180,000 miles. Overall, the data shows a distribution skewed towards lower to mid-range mileages, indicating most vehicles are likely to have been used for regular but not extensive driving.

The data indicates that among the sampled Volvo XC90 models from 2014 to 2019, the majority were manufactured in the final two years of that range. Specifically, approximately 48.8% of these vehicles were built in 2018, and 51.2% in 2019. This suggests a relatively even split, with a slight emphasis on 2019 models, highlighting that these vehicles are predominantly recent models within that time frame.

Based on the data for the Volvo XC90 (2014-19), the most common main paint colour is black, accounting for 35.4% of the sample. Grey is also popular, representing 25.6%, followed by blue at 15.9%. Silver makes up 13.4%, while white is less common at 8.5%, and red is quite rare at just 1.2%. Overall, darker colours like black and grey dominate, suggesting a preference for more neutral and classic shades among these vehicles.

The data indicates that nearly a quarter (23.2%) of the Volvo XC90 (2014-19) vehicles have only a single registered keeper, suggesting that some vehicles remain with their original owner for extended periods. Additionally, half of the vehicles (50%) have had exactly two keepers, which could imply moderate ownership changes. Fewer vehicles have had more than three owners, with only 24.4% having three keepers and a small 2.4% with four. This distribution points to a relatively stable ownership pattern overall, with the majority of vehicles experiencing limited ownership changes.
